TOPSHAM — Ben Lucas threw four touchdowns and Brandon St. Michel rushed for two more to lead the Cony football team past Mt. Ararat 57-28 in a Pine Tree Conference Class A game Friday night.

“We played really well, especially in the first half,” Cony coach Robby Vachon said. “Offensively, defensively and special teams, we came to play.”

The Rams (2-1), who’ve won two straight, led 21-0 after the first quarter and 43-0 at the half. Most of the starters rested in the second half.

St. Michel rushed for touchdown runs of 15 and 6 yards in the first quarter.

“We opened up some big holes for him,” Vachon said. “But he also made a lot of people miss in the open field.”

St. Michel then hauled in a 15-yard touchdown pass from Lucas later in the first quarter.

Lucas threw three touchdown passes in the second quarter to three different receivers — Chandler Shostak, Dayshawn Roberts and Taylor Carrier.

“We had talked about what we needed to do to get better,” Vachon said, “and we did that. We controlled the tempo.”
